## 图片RGB及其应用 ### 引言 在计算机视觉和图像处理领域,RGB(红色、绿色、蓝色)是一种用于表示颜色的加法混色模式。在这种模式下,每种颜色的强度可以通过一个8位的整数值来表示,范围从0到255。通过调整这三个颜色通道的强度,我们可以创建出各种颜色,并且通过操纵图像的RGB,我们可以进行各种图像处理操作,如颜色校正、图像分割等。 在本文中,我们将介绍如何使用Python来获取
原创 2023-09-10 12:17:13
194阅读
# Python获取图片RGB的实现步骤 作为一名经验丰富的开发者,我将会教你如何使用Python获取图片RGB。下面是整个实现过程的步骤: | 步骤 | 描述 | | --- | --- | | 步骤一 | 导入必要的库 | | 步骤二 | 加载图片 | | 步骤三 | 获取图片RGB | | 步骤四 | 可视化RGB | 现在,让我们逐步进行每一步的实现。 ## 步骤一:导
原创 2024-01-20 08:36:55
261阅读
今天是持续写作的第 36 / 100 天。 如果你有想要交流的想法、技术,欢迎在评论区留言。今天这 1 个小时,继续给大家打来 Python 读取图片这一简单的操作。读取单通道使用 OpenCV 可以读取某个图片的单一通道,啥叫通道,经过检索,找到了一个相对清楚的解释,希望你也可以看明白。比较通俗易懂的解释是:灰度图的通道数为 1,彩色图的通道为 3。基本上,描述一个像素点,如果是灰度,那么只需要
最近有一个小程序用到了cifare10数据集,下载得到的是batch文件,由于想要以图片的形式看一下数据,所以就写了几行很简单的代码。cifare10数据是32×32×3的图片(即RGB三通道图片)。首先读取一张图片RGB三通道数值,存放在r,g,b三个list中,每个list的len为32×32,然后依次放入一个image对象中,image.show()即可查看。(可以把list转换为对应32
转载 2023-06-09 00:24:50
328阅读
1.vc2.imread()cv2.imread读出的图片格式是uint8;value是numpy array;图像数据是以BGR的格式进行存储的,注意是BGR,通道默认范围0-255,需要将存储类型改成RGB的形式才能正常显示原图的颜色。图片维度可以表示为(h,w,c)2.PIL.Image.open()PIL是有自己的数据结构的,类型是<class ‘PIL.Image.Image’&
# Python获取图片RGB ## 简介 在计算机视觉和图像处理领域,获取图片RGB是一项常见任务。RGB(红绿蓝)是一种将颜色表示为红色、绿色和蓝色三个通道的方式。在这篇文章中,我们将介绍如何使用Python获取图片RGB,并给出代码示例。 ## 准备工作 在开始之前,我们需要确保安装了Python的Pillow库。Pillow是一个功能强大的图像处理库,可以用于打开、操作和保
原创 2023-07-22 17:11:26
925阅读
# 如何用Python打印图片RGB ## 简介 作为一名经验丰富的开发者,我将向你展示如何在Python中打印图片RGB。这对于刚入行的新手来说可能会有些困难,但是只要按照以下步骤一步步操作,你会很快掌握这个技能。 ## 整体流程 首先我们来看一下整个实现的流程: ```mermaid stateDiagram 图片加载 -> 图片处理 -> 打印RGB ``` ##
原创 2024-05-05 05:56:06
42阅读
# Python遍历图片获取通道RGB 在图像处理领域,Python是一种常用的编程语言。Python提供了丰富的库和工具,使得图像处理变得简单高效。本文将介绍如何使用Python遍历图片并获取图像的通道RGB。 ## 什么是RGB RGB是一种颜色模型,其中R代表红色(Red),G代表绿色(Green),B代表蓝色(Blue)。在RGB颜色模型中,每个像素通过组合不同的红、绿、蓝三种颜
原创 2023-08-23 12:39:06
332阅读
1读取和修改像素可以通过行列坐标访问像素.对于BGR图,它返回一个蓝色、绿色、红色通道的数组.对于灰度图,仅返回相应的强度.代码:import numpy as np import cv2 img = cv2.imread('img.jpg') px = img[32,32]#访问(32,32)坐标像素 print(px) [ 33 108 57] print(img[32,32,0])
## Python获取图片特定点RGB的流程 为了帮助你实现Python获取图片特定点RGB的功能,我将提供一个简单的流程来指导你完成这个任务。下面是整个流程的步骤表格: | 步骤 | 描述 | | ---- | ---- | | 1 | 读取图片 | | 2 | 获取特定点的坐标 | | 3 | 获取该点的RGB | 接下来,我将详细介绍每个步骤需要做的事情,并提供相应的代码示例。请
原创 2024-01-18 07:15:48
130阅读
前言最近工作有个需求,获取某张图片某个像素颜色,生成该颜色的纯色图片。所以写了一个工具,分享给大家,如果大家也有一样的场景,可以直接使用。依赖安装需要使用opencv以及numpy。安装命令如下:pip install opencv-python -i https://pypi.douban.com/simple pip install numpy -i https://pypi.douban.c
转载 2023-05-26 22:05:58
690阅读
  前言 图片对比获取坐标的方法很多,我选择了比较简单的方法:对比rgb。要想对比rgb,就得先获取图片rgb。运用的是BufferedImage里的getRGNB方法。 解决方案 主要思路: 首先用.getWidth和.getHeight方法获取图片的宽度和高度,用.getMinX和.getMinY方法获取最小x,y坐标值。再循环图片所有点坐标,并且用getRGB获取其rgb,这里
原创 2021-06-29 17:48:35
2016阅读
## 用Python遍历图片获取通道RGB 在计算机视觉和图像处理中,我们经常需要对图像的每个像素进行操作。其中一个常见的任务是遍历图像并获取每个像素的RGBPython作为一种强大的编程语言,提供了许多库和函数来处理图像。在本文中,我们将使用Python来遍历图像并获取每个像素的RGB。 ### 图像和RGB通道 在了解如何遍历图像之前,我们首先需要了解图像是如何存储的以及什么是R
原创 2023-09-01 07:48:09
341阅读
一、原理与思路图像由无数的像数构成,python读取图片每一像数点的灰度,从黑-白的灰度为0~255,即越黑的地方灰度越小,越白的地方灰度越大。显然,我们希望越黑的地方灰度越大,因此需要做一个反转,即用255减去各个像数点灰度。接着,将所有非条带部分的像数点灰度改为0,而蛋白条带部分灰度保持不变。最后,只要识别出每个蛋白条带的区域,将其中所有像数点灰度和。 图1&nbsp
# 如何在Python中获取图片每个像素的RGB ## 1. 整体流程 ```mermaid flowchart TD A(加载图片) --> B(获取图片像素数据) B --> C(遍历像素) C --> D(获取RGB) ``` ## 2. 具体步骤 ### 步骤1:加载图片 ```python from PIL import Image # 读取图片
原创 2024-06-14 03:39:22
465阅读
# 获取透明图片RGB ——Python 教程 在计算机视觉和图像处理的世界里,获取图片RGB 是一项常见的任务。特别是对于具有透明背景的图片,我们不仅需要获取 RGB ,还要处理透明度通道。本文将详细指导您如何使用 Python 获取透明图片RGB 。 ## 流程步骤 在开始之前,我们先来看看整个流程的步骤: | 步骤 | 说明
原创 7月前
78阅读
# 从灰度图片RGB图片的转换 在Python中,我们经常会遇到需要将灰度图片转换为RGB图片的情况。灰度图片是指每个像素点只有一个灰度,而RGB图片是指每个像素点有红、绿、蓝三个通道的颜色。下面将介绍如何使用Python实现这个转换过程。 ## 安装依赖库 首先,我们需要安装必要的依赖库`numpy`和`PIL`,分别用于处理数值计算和图像处理。 ```markdown ``
原创 2024-04-07 03:53:42
535阅读
PrettyPrinter是Python 3.6 及以上版本中的一个功能强大、支持语法高亮、描述性的美化打印包。它使用了改进的Wadler-Leijen布局算法,和Haskell打印美化库中的prettyprinter以及anti-wl-pprint、 JavaScript的Prettier、Ruby的prettypreinter.rb 以及 IPython的Ipython.lib.pretty类
# 提取图片RGB888像素的方法 随着数字图像处理的发展,人们对于图像的处理需求也日益增加。在很多应用中,我们需要对图片RGB像素进行提取和分析。本文将介绍如何使用Python来提取一幅图片RGB888像素,并展示一些简单的应用。 ## RGB888像素简介 在数字图像处理中,RGB模式是最常用的颜色模式之一。RGB模式将颜色表示为红、绿、蓝三种基本颜色的组合。每种颜色通道的取
原创 2024-04-29 05:56:34
254阅读
# 如何在Java中设置图片RGB ## 简介 在Java中,我们可以通过设置图片RGB来实现图片颜色的调整。在本篇文章中,我将会向你介绍如何实现这一功能。 ## 整体流程 首先,让我们来看一下整个流程,可以用表格展示步骤: | 步骤 | 操作 | | --- | --- | | 1 | 读取图片文件 | | 2 | 获取图片的BufferedImage对象 | | 3 | 遍历图片
原创 2024-07-07 06:12:30
77阅读
  • 1
  • 2
  • 3
  • 4
  • 5